• Title/Summary/Keyword: 시뮬레이션 도구

Search Result 648, Processing Time 0.027 seconds

Implementation of Tactical Path-finding Integrated with Weight Learning (가중치 학습과 결합된 전술적 경로 찾기의 구현)

  • Yu, Kyeon-Ah
    • Journal of the Korea Society for Simulation
    • /
    • v.19 no.2
    • /
    • pp.91-98
    • /
    • 2010
  • Conventional path-finding has focused on finding short collision-free paths. However, as computer games become more sophisticated, it is required to take tactical information like ambush points or lines of enemy sight into account. One way to make this information have an effect on path-finding is to represent a heuristic function of a search algorithm as a weighted sum of tactics. In this paper we consider the problem of learning heuristic to optimize path-finding based on given tactical information. What is meant by learning is to produce a good weight vector for a heuristic function. Training examples for learning are given by a game level-designer and will be compared with search results in every search level to update weights. This paper proposes a learning algorithm integrated with search for tactical path-finding. The perceptron-like method for updating weights is described and a simulation tool for implementing these is presented. A level-designer can mark desired paths according to characters' properties in the heuristic learning tool and then it uses them as training examples to learn weights and shows traces of paths changing along with weight learning.

Development of Computational Science Simulation Management Program in Heterogeneous Computing Environments (이종 컴퓨팅 환경에서의 계산과학 시뮬레이션 관리 프로그램 개발)

  • Byun, Hee-Jung;Yu, Jung-Lok
    • The Journal of the Korea Contents Association
    • /
    • v.18 no.8
    • /
    • pp.9-17
    • /
    • 2018
  • Heterogeneous high performance computing systems are gaining acceptance as the environments for computational scientific simulations of various application fields. Those computing systems, however, have been mostly used with the legacy consoles, resulting in the severe decrement of accessibility and usability of heterogeneous computing assets. To solve this problem, this paper presents the design and implementation of web-based computational science simulation management program. The proposed program provides fundamental primitives including user authentication, data management, physical/virtual computing resource management, job management, etc. that can be used to manage different kinds of simulations efficiently, and also offers highly extensible feature through a modular plug-in architecture. We also present the best practical examples of applications (e.g., scientific simulation education and bio-medical) to confirm our program's effectiveness.

Generating Korean synthetic populations by using the iterative proportional updating method (Iterative Proportional Updating 방법을 이용한 한국 가상 인구 데이터 생성)

  • Son, Woo-Sik;Kwon, Okyu;Lee, Sang-Hee
    • Journal of the Korea Society for Simulation
    • /
    • v.25 no.4
    • /
    • pp.13-20
    • /
    • 2016
  • Microsimulation model has aimed to simulate the impact of policy at the level of individual and household. Recently, microsimulation model has been widely accepted in OECD countries for evaluating their economic and social policies. For improving the availability of microsimulation model, the population data which shows good accordance with the official statistics should be required. In this paper, we generate Korean synthetic populations by using the iterative proportional updating method. For the validation of Korean synthetic populations, we compute the difference between the generated synthetic populations and the summary table of Korean census. Then, we confirm that it shows good accordance with the summary table.

Accelerated Large-Scale Simulation on DEVS based Hybrid System using Collaborative Computation on Multi-Cores and GPUs (멀티 코어와 GPU 결합 구조를 이용한 DEVS 기반 대규모 하이브리드 시스템 모델링 시뮬레이션의 가속화)

  • Kim, Seongseop;Cho, Jeonghun;Park, Daejin
    • Journal of the Korea Society for Simulation
    • /
    • v.27 no.3
    • /
    • pp.1-11
    • /
    • 2018
  • Discrete event system specification (DEVS) has been used in many simulations including hybrid systems featuring both discrete and continuous behavior that require a lot of time to get results. Therefore, in this study, we proposed the acceleration of a DEVS-based hybrid system simulation using multi-cores and GPUs tightly coupled computing. We analyzed the proposed heterogeneous computing of the simulation in terms of the configuration of the target device, changing simulation parameters, and power consumption for efficient simulation. The result revealed that the proposed architecture offers an advantage for high-performance simulation in terms of execution time, although more power consumption is required. With these results, we discovered that our approach is applicable in hybrid system simulation, and we demonstrated the possibility of optimized hardware distribution in terms of power consumption versus execution time via experiments in the proposed architecture.

Formal Design and Verification of Cache Coherency Protocol by ESTEREL (ESTEREL을 이용한 Cache Coherency Protocol의 정형 설계 및 검증)

  • 김민숙;최진영
    • Proceedings of the Korean Information Science Society Conference
    • /
    • 2002.04a
    • /
    • pp.40-42
    • /
    • 2002
  • 캐쉬 일관성 유지 프로토콜은 공유 메모리 다중 프로세서 시스템의 정확하고 효율적인 작동에 중요하다. 시스템이 점점 복잡해짐에 따라 시뮬레이션 방법만으로는 프로토콜의 정확성을 확인하기는 어렵다. 본 논문에서는 CC-NUMA용 디렉토리 기반 캐쉬 일관성 프로토콜인 RACE 프로토콜을 정형기법 도구인 ESTEREL을 이용하여 프로토콜이 안정적으로 동작함을 검증하였다.

  • PDF

A Perceptive Opinion on Design Optimization for Shell Structures (쉘 구조물의 설계최적화에 대한 인식적인 견해)

  • 이상진
    • Computational Structural Engineering
    • /
    • v.17 no.2
    • /
    • pp.24-30
    • /
    • 2004
  • 21세기에 들어서면서 구조설계최적화 알고리듬이 성숙 단계에 이르렀다. 이 단계에 도달하기까지 설계최적화와 관련한 매우 다양한 개념이 소개되었으며 이러한 개념은 구조물의 성능을 향상시키기 위한 컴퓨터 시뮬레이션 도구의 개발로 이어지고 있다. (중략)

웹기반에서의 멀티미디어 저작도구개발에 대한 기술동향

  • 김태석;이춘근
    • Korea Multimedia Society
    • /
    • v.5 no.1
    • /
    • pp.87-95
    • /
    • 2001
  • 정보기술 기반의 사회를 맞이하는 시점에서 멀티미디어를 기반으로하는 정보화 사회(Information Society)와 지식기반 사회(Knowledge-based Society)는 현재와 미래를 규정하는 거시적 패러다임으로 인식되고 있다. 정보 기술 사회(Information Technology Society)로 정착해 가는 시점에 처해 있는 우리 사회는 농경 사회와 산업 사회의 논리로는 도저히 해석되지 않은 각종의 시스템 시뮬레이션 모델들이 끊임없이 제시되고 있으며, 그것이 실제로 실현되는 가히 혁명적인 상황 속에 놓여 있다.(중략)

  • PDF

Modeling & Implementation of Operational Test and Evaluation, Offline Monitoring Software for Korea Augmentation Satellite System Uplink Station (한국형 위성항법 보정시스템 위성통신국 운용시험평가 오프라인감시 소프트웨어 모델링 및 구현)

  • Lee, Sanguk;You, Moonhee;Hyoung, Chang-Hee;Jeong, InCheol;Choi, SangHyouk;Sin, Cheon Sig
    • Journal of Satellite, Information and Communications
    • /
    • v.11 no.4
    • /
    • pp.74-80
    • /
    • 2016
  • In this paper, the modeling and implementation results of the operational test and evaluation tool of the KASS up-link station composed of the GEO(Geostationary Earth Orbit) satellite signal analysis tool model that analyzes the GEO satellite signal and the GEO message analysis tool model that analyzes the GEO satellite navigation message. In addition, we describe the results of software modeling and implementation of some software models of GEO satellite and KASS up-link stations that can generate and provide simulated signals to operational test and evaluation tools of these KASS up-link stations.

Data Mining Tool for Stock Investors' Decision Support (주식 투자자의 의사결정 지원을 위한 데이터마이닝 도구)

  • Kim, Sung-Dong
    • The Journal of the Korea Contents Association
    • /
    • v.12 no.2
    • /
    • pp.472-482
    • /
    • 2012
  • There are many investors in the stock market, and more and more people get interested in the stock investment. In order to avoid risks and make profit in the stock investment, we have to determine several aspects using various information. That is, we have to select profitable stocks and determine appropriate buying/selling prices and holding period. This paper proposes a data mining tool for the investors' decision support. The data mining tool makes stock investors apply machine learning techniques and generate stock price prediction model. Also it helps determine buying/selling prices and holding period. It supports individual investor's own decision making using past data. Using the proposed tool, users can manage stock data, generate their own stock price prediction models, and establish trading policy via investment simulation. Users can select technical indicators which they think affect future stock price. Then they can generate stock price prediction models using the indicators and test the models. They also perform investment simulation using proper models to find appropriate trading policy consisting of buying/selling prices and holding period. Using the proposed data mining tool, stock investors can expect more profit with the help of stock price prediction model and trading policy validated on past data, instead of with an emotional decision.

Dynamic Interest Management in Web Simulation for Intelligent Transportation System (지능형 교통 시스템을 위한 동적 정보관리 시뮬레이션)

  • Cho, Kyu-Cheol
    • Journal of the Korea Society for Simulation
    • /
    • v.28 no.2
    • /
    • pp.15-22
    • /
    • 2019
  • Simulation methods are being studied for various service models that can be used in industries as the development of web technology. DEVS is being used as a tool to simulate through scenarios using various information. In addition, DEVS/WS integrates web-based DEVS models through a distributed computing environment and can be used as tools for high-performance computing and data distribution. This paper describes a method for simulating an intelligent transportation system in DEVS/WS environment. This paper propose dynamic interest management model(DIMM) applied the genetic algorithm, manage efficiently road information of moving node. And, this paper evaluates performance of the dynamic interest management model in comparing to the none interest management model(NIMM). The transmitted messages and simulation time of the DIMM is saved than that of the NIMM.